Title: Re: Remote access and screen resolution
Post by: whoismoses on January 23, 2018, 08:29:30 PM
Pick up one of these. They make the PC think it has a monitor and it keeps the 1080p resolution.

https://www.amazon.com/gp/product/B06XT1Z9TF

Title: Re: Remote access and screen resolution
Post by: Alyeska on January 23, 2018, 09:04:24 PM
Pick up one of these. They make the PC think it has a monitor and it keeps the 1080p resolution.

https://www.amazon.com/gp/product/B06XT1Z9TF

This is the correct answer, I have one plugged into the on board HDMI port of three separate mining rig motherboards, and now they are all full resolution when I remote in, very similar to the link and I picked mine up at Amazon as well.
